IN response to an invitation to place before the members information concerning the modern special steels with the aim of simplifying their task in availing themselves of the latest metallurgical products, Dr. T. Swinden, director of research to the United Steel Companies, Ltd., delivered before the North East Coast Institution of Engineers and Shipbuilders, on February 25, a paper in which he surveyed the developments of recent years in this sphere. Although his remarks were in many instances more particularly pointed to their applications in hulls, marine boilers, superheaters and engines, his review of the chemical and physical properties of special steels, their amenability to heat treatment, their weld ability and their resistance to corrosion and embrittlement were of even wider interest to the engineering profession.
